LR acquires Acoura in move to strengthen market leading position for food safety assurance services

 

20 December 2016 - Lloyd’s Register (LR), the global engineering, technical and business services organisation, has acquired Acoura, the UK’s leading compliance and safety specialists for the food and drink industry, to strengthen the market-leading position of LRQA’s food safety assurance services. LRQA is a member of the LR group and a leading provider of professional assurance services.

 

With over 28,000 customers in the food and beverage sector, Acoura is one of the UK’s leading providers of risk and compliance services and uses scalable supply chain technology solutions to deliver a wide range of food inspection, advisory and training services.

 

The acquisition of Acoura will strengthen LRQA’s position within the food sector by expanding their offer into new markets, underpinned with technology. Together, LRQA and Acoura will offer a unique proposition to the global food sector thereby delivering increased brand protection for customers through end-to-end supply chain assurance from farm to fork.

One of Acoura’s main clients is red meat promotion body Quality Meat Scotland (QMS) for which it currently delivers an independent assessment service as part of the quality assurance schemes which underpin the Scotch Beef PGI, Scotch Lamb PGI and Specially Selected Pork brands.

 

Uel Morton, Chief Executive of QMS, said: “Today’s announcement represents a fresh chapter in the history of Acoura, previously known as SFQC (Scottish Food Quality Certification). Quality assurance plays a crucial role in reassuring consumers about the integrity of the meat they buy. Given Lloyd’s Register’s impressive pedigree in this field of operation, we are fully confident that Acoura will continue to fully deliver its important remit for our industry.”

About LR

Lloyd’s Register (LR) is a global engineering, technical and business services organisation wholly owned by the Lloyd’s Register Foundation, a UK charity dedicated to research and education in science and engineering. Founded in 1760 as a marine classification society, LR now operates across many industry sectors, with around 8,000 employees in 78 countries.

 

LR has a long-standing reputation for integrity, impartiality and technical excellence. About Acoura

Acoura is accredited by ASI, ANSI and UKAS to provide inspections for around 60 standards and scopes and also have a longstanding track record of developing and delivering assurance schemes for the food and drink sector. With offices in Edinburgh and Stevenage they can call upon the services of over 400 specialist staff and industry associates to help customers across the supply chain protect their brand and safeguard consumers from harm.

 

Operating in their sectors for over 20 years, Acoura certifies all of Scotland’s assured red meat and farmed salmon while also providing around half of the UK’s dairies with audits against the Red Tractor Standard. Additionally, they have grown to become the world’s largest provider of sustainable fisheries inspections with close to 50% of the market.

 

Their technology solutions are also used by several leading hospitality providers to offer supplier compliance, menu verification, allergen identification and complaint management solutions – safeguarding millions of meals served to the public every week. www.acoura.com
